Justice for Kayla Moore at Berkeley City Council this Tuesday!

This Tuesday at 7pm at the City Council Chambers, 2134 Martin Luther King, Jr. Way, Berkeley.


Please attend the Berkeley City Council meeting THIS Tuesday, November 12th at 7pm. The Council will be voting on a plan that is coming from the Community Health Commission and the NAACP that clearly lists some of the changes that Justice for Kayla Moore is also seeking. The council will vote on a list of recommendations that come out of a long process that includes the NAACP Town Hall meeting from last August.

Please come! Please speak! Please let the council know that you support their recommendations including:


* Implement a policy of non-Police involvement with Mental Health Services (BPD to have backup role for life-threatening matters).


* Implement the operations of the Mental Health Mobile Crisis Unit to operate 24 hours, 7 days a week.
